The Power of GIS Analysis in Spatial Data Interpretation

In the context of data-driven decision-making, geographic information systems (GIS) analytics stand as a beacon of clarity in a sea of ​​information Combining geography, technology, and data science, GIS research offers a unique perspective on understanding spatial relationships, patterns, and processes. From urban planning to the environment, from epidemiology to transportation policy, the applications of GIS analysis are limitless, providing valuable insights that stimulate the decision-making process as it knows.

At its core, GIS research involves analyzing, interpreting, and manipulating geographic data to uncover meaningful insights. This information can come from a variety of sources, including satellite imagery, aerial photography, GPS systems, and socioeconomic surveys. By integrating these data sets, GIS analysts can develop detailed spatial models that reveal relationships and complexity.

In addition, GIS analysis facilitates spatial querying and spatial computation, enabling researchers to gain valuable insights from geographic data sets. Through techniques such as proximity analysis, spatial projection, and network analysis, GIS professionals can identify spatial patterns, clusters, and connections that may not be apparent in traditional data analysis methods. This insight can inform a wide range of decision-making processes, from optimizing supply chains to identifying suitable locations for new infrastructure projects.

In addition to its analytical capabilities, GIS analysis plays an important role in supporting evidence-based policy and policy. By providing decision-makers with accurate and up-to-date geographic information, GIS analysis empowers them to develop strategies based on evidence. Whether it’s zoning regulations, land use planning, or disaster planning, GIS analysis provides planners with the tools they need to make appropriate choices that benefit the community as a whole.

Furthermore, GIS analysis is increasingly being used to address pressing global challenges such as climate change, biodiversity loss, and urbanization. Using spatial data and advanced analytics, researchers can assess the impact of environmental change, model future conditions, and develop strategies for sustainable development From mapping deforestation in the Amazon rain forest to tracking ice melting at sea, GIS analysis is critical to understanding the complex interactions between human activity and the natural environment around the intersection.
